KCCR CONGRATULATES PROF. (MRS.) AMA AGYEIBEA AMUASI ON HER RE-ELECTION AS VICE-DEAN OF THE SCHOOL OF DENTISTRY

July 16, 2026

The Kumasi Centre for Collaborative Research in Tropical Medicine (KCCR) congratulates Prof. (Mrs.) Ama Agyeibea Amuasi, Senior Research Fellow in the Global Health & Infectious Diseases Research Group, on her re-election as Vice-Dean of the School of Dentistry at Kwame Nkrumah University of Science and Technology (KNUST).

Prof. (Mrs.) Ama Agyeibea Amuasi was re-elected after securing 100% of the valid votes cast, reflecting the confidence in her leadership and dedication to academic excellence.

The KCCR community celebrates this remarkable achievement and wishes her continued success in her leadership and service.
